Ok. <div><br></div><div>So if I used a ready made captive portal solution, would my solution still work? </div><div><br></div><div>Captive Portal authenticates users (using FreeRadius?)</div><div>WLAN controller delivers an IP.</div>
<div><br><br><div class="gmail_quote">On Wed, Dec 10, 2008 at 2:38 AM,  <span dir="ltr"><<a href="mailto:tnt@kalik.net">tnt@kalik.net</a>></span> wrote:<br><blockquote class="gmail_quote" style="margin:0 0 0 .8ex;border-left:1px #ccc solid;padding-left:1ex;">
<div class="Ih2E3d">>Yes I do plan on using a RoR application to make the changes to the MySQL<br>
>database.<br>
>So I think this is coming together. However, the username and password...<br>
>where is the user responsible for using those credentials.<br>
><br>
>Would a user connect to my WiFi network, then authenticate against the<br>
>RADIUS server using credentials obtained through a Ruby on Rails<br>
>application?<br>
><br>
>Here's the workflow I am thinking to build this:<br>
><br>
>1. User connects to WiFi network.<br>
>2. User is directed to a Ruby on Rails application.<br>
>3. Application authorizes user to connect, creates credentials<br>
>and propagates them to FreeRadius.<br>
>4. Application gives credentials to user.<br>
>5. User enters credentials (where?)<br>
><br>
<br>
</div>Oh, you are thinking of building a captive portal, not just something<br>
that will adminster users.<br>
<div class="Ih2E3d"><br>
>I need hotspot functionality so I am almost there in terms of everything I<br>
>need to build. Are these points rational?<br>
<br>
</div>Probably not. How long do you think on spending on this? Months? Years?<br>
<div class="Ih2E3d"><br>
>Also, where are the credentials<br>
>entered in #5?<br>
<br>
</div>If you are seriously thinking of making a captive portal (and not using<br>
ready made one) - you will have to make user interface too.<br>
<div class="Ih2E3d"><br>
>Wouldn't I just need to deliver an IP or something to that<br>
>machine at that point?<br>
><br>
<br>
</div>Oh no. There is so much more to it than that.<br>
<div><div></div><div class="Wj3C7c"><br>
Ivan Kalik<br>
Kalik Informatika ISP<br>
<br>
-<br>
List info/subscribe/unsubscribe? See <a href="http://www.freeradius.org/list/users.html" target="_blank">http://www.freeradius.org/list/users.html</a><br>
</div></div></blockquote></div><br><br clear="all"><br>-- <br>Matthew Carriere<br><a href="mailto:matthew@blackninjasoftware.com">matthew@blackninjasoftware.com</a><br>
</div>